Thailand to sit on ECOSOC

BANKOK, 15 June 2019(NNT) - Thailand has been selected as a member of the United Nations Economic and Social Council from 2020 to 2022 on behalf of Asia and the Pacific region alongside China, South Korea and Bangladesh.

 

Thailand won 186 votes in the selection process. Thailand’s Foreign Affairs Minister Don Paramudwinai also participated in the session. Last time Thailand was an ECOSOC member was from 2005 to 2007.

 

ECOSOC is one of six major United Nations organizations which is in charge of proposing and reviewing international policy toward economic, social and environmental development. ECOSOC has supported the world’s goal of achieving sustainable development by 2030. From among a total of 54 ECOSOC member countries worldwide, Thailand will have the opportunity to take part in proposing international policy toward partnerships for sustainable development cooperation.

 

Besides, Thailand can share outstanding experiences in sustainable development under the guidance of the Sufficiency Economy.

Thailand elected to the ECOSOC for 2020-2022 after 12 year absence

In a media statement, released on Friday (June 14th), Thailand’s Ministry of Foreign Affairs reported that the country is among four from the Asia-Pacific group elected by the United Nations General Assembly (UNGA) to the United Nations Economic and Social Council (ECOSOC).

 

The three other countries are China, Bangladesh and South Korea. Thailand received 186 votes, ranking it first among the candidates in the Asia-Pacific group. The 54-member body is one of the six principal UN organisations and is the central forum for discussion of international economic and social issues and policies.

 

The UNGA elects the ECOSOC members yearly to overlapping 3-year terms. Countries from Asia and the Pacific Region are given a quota of 11 out of the 54 council memberships. The last period during which Thailand served on the ECOSOC was 2005-2007.
